Product Introduction

Overview

The TLE2021CDR is a high-performance, low-power, precision operational amplifier manufactured by Texas Instruments. This single-channel device is designed for applications requiring high-speed signal processing with minimal power consumption. It is part of the TLE202x series, which leverages advanced Excalibur technology to deliver superior performance in terms of slew rate and unity-gain bandwidth. The TLE2021CDR is particularly suited for precision analog circuits in industrial, medical, and consumer electronics.

Applications

The TLE2021CDR is widely used in various precision analog applications, including sensor signal conditioning, data acquisition systems, and medical instrumentation. Its high-speed and low-power characteristics make it ideal for portable devices and battery-powered systems. Additionally, it is suitable for industrial control systems where precision and reliability are critical.
